The club hasn’t raced since February but will hold 10 races, with with first at 12.57pm.
The first race, the Get Well Danny Smith Stakes (320m), has been named for one of the club’s biggest supporters.
Smith, who usually collects the rug after the greyhounds have raced, has broken his leg.
Barry Hull’s Penguin Man and Leonard Holmes’ Little Whacko are both looking to make it a hat-trick of wins.
Penguin Man has won his only two starts to date, both at Temora while Little Whacko has won three of his last four starts.
It will be a busy day at the Showground with a harness racing meeting to follow.
